When it comes to maintaining a healthy and radiant smile, regular dental check-ups are your smile's best friend. These routine appointments are not just about getting your teeth cleaned; they play a pivotal role in preventing dental issues, catching problems early, and ensuring your oral health remains in top shape. In this blog post, we'll delve into the significant reasons why dental check-ups are essential for your overall well-being. 1. Early Detection of Dental Issues One of the primary benefits of dental check-ups is early detection. Your dentist has the expertise to identify dental problems in their initial stages before they become major concerns. Whether it's a tiny cavity, gum inflammation, or early signs of oral cancer, catching these issues early can lead to more straightforward and less expensive treatments. 2. Preventing Tooth Decay and Gum Disease Regular dental cleanings are an integral part of your check-up. Even with excellent oral hygiene practices at home, some areas of your mouth may be challenging to clean thoroughly. Professional cleanings help remove tartar buildup, which can lead to tooth decay and gum disease if left unchecked. 3. Maintaining Oral Hygiene Habits Your dentist can provide personalized guidance on your oral hygiene routine. They can recommend specific toothbrushes, toothpaste, and mouthwash tailored to your needs. This ensures that you're using the most effective products to maintain your oral health. 4. Customized Dental Care Every smile is unique, and your dental check-up takes this into account. Your dentist will create a customized treatment plan based on your specific oral health needs and goals. Whether you're interested in cosmetic dentistry, orthodontics, or restorative procedures, your dentist can outline a plan to help you achieve your desired smile. 5. Preventing Tooth Loss
By addressing dental issues early, dental check-ups can help prevent tooth loss. When problems like cavities, gum disease, or infection are left untreated, they can lead to tooth extraction. Regular check-ups can help you keep your natural teeth intact. 6. Promoting Overall Health Oral health is closely linked to overall health. Conditions like gum disease have been associated with an increased risk of systemic health problems, including heart disease, diabetes, and respiratory issues. By maintaining good oral health through check-ups, you're also contributing to your overall well-being. 7. Peace of Mind Knowing that your oral health is in good hands can provide peace of mind. Regular dental check-ups allow you to stay proactive about your oral health and address any concerns promptly.
